A Brief Explanation Regarding The Chanduva Fish

The Chanduva fish has a number of positive effects on one's health. It is claimed that eating fish can increase total body growth, memory improvement, and body strengthening. In addition, toddlers and adults appreciate the gently sweet taste accentuated by the delicate structure of the food.

 

There are three distinct categories in which chanduva fish might be placed. They represent

 

1. White or Silver Chanduva

 

2. Chanduva, or Chinese Chanduva

 

3. Chanduva nervosa or Black Chanduva

 

In Bengali, the Chanduva fish is called Roopchand, while in English, it is called Pomfret. However, the Telugu word for the black pomfret is "Nalla Chanduva," and the Telugu word for the silver pomfret is "Tella Chanduva." In the United States, the Butterfish and the Pompano refer to the same fish species.

 

Some Fascinating Information Regarding The Chanduva Fish

The Chanduva fish stands out in the marine market for several reasons, including the following unique facts about the species.

 

1. The fish with a flattened body known as Chanduvas have a single, long dorsal fin extending their bodies' length and strongly forked tails.

 

2. The dorsal fins of Chanduva fish are frequently larger than their anal fins.

 

3. Unlike bangda fish or sardines fish, chanduva fish do not form schools, and they can be found at the surface as well as in the deeper layers of the water column.

 

4. The salpids, hydromedusae, or macrozooplankton are the principal sources of nutrition for the Chanduva fish.

 

5. When compared to Chanduva fish found in freshwater, marine Chanduva fish have a much greater ratio of total omega-3 to omega-6 fatty acids in their bodies.

 

6. The black and white Chanduva fish are the most frequent species in Indian waters.

 

7. Chanduva is well-known for its flavorful, muted, non-fishy flavour and its delicate, white flesh. It is also the most popular choice of meat because of its tenderness and ease of breaking apart after being plated.

The Chanduva Fish Is Beneficial To One's Health

How can we avoid talking about the benefits of fish to one's health? So now, let's look at some of the positive effects of eating Chanduva fish on your body.

 

1. The chanduva fish has omega-3 fatty acids, which are necessary for human beings. Therefore, it is beneficial to the heart and overall cardiovascular health and assists in managing blood pressure.

 

2. Eating Chanduva fish on a regular basis strengthens both the immune system and the metabolic process; this is best to consume during seasonal changes to strengthen the immunity.

 

3. The chanduva fish is beneficial for lowering stress levels and improving memory ability.

 

4. The vitamin D found in Chanduva fish may promote the growth of bone tissue and assist in regenerating the cells that make up our skin.

 

5. The Chanduva fish contains retinol, which is fantastic for enhancing eyesight and also assists in reducing the appearance of blurry vision. People with surgeries and eye-related medical conditions should incorporate this fish into their diets.

 

6. The fatty acids found in fish are beneficial in reducing inflammation in the tissues and relieving the symptoms of rheumatoid arthritis.

 

7. It is believed that the lean protein in fish helps to maintain healthy cardiovascular (CVD) function.

 

8. The doctor advises patients who suffer from mental diseases to consume Chanduva fish. It helps reduce stress levels, which in turn increases the functioning of the brain.
